Buying Guide: Key Purchase Considerations

  • What size fits my bathroom? Measure available floor and counter space. If you have limited room, a compact round sink or a wall-mounted vanity may be ideal.
  • What style do I want? Choose between modern, contemporary, or classic aesthetics. Rectangular vessels tend to skew modern, while marble-look finishes suit traditional spaces.
  • Material and maintenance: Ceramic and porcelain are durable and easy to clean. Non-porous surfaces resist staining and scratches better over time.
  • Storage needs: If you store towels or toiletries, prioritize vanities with drawers or cabinets. For minimalism, floating designs reduce visual clutter.
  • Installation considerations: Countertop vessels often need standard drain kits and faucet compatibility. Some models include pre-drilled holes; verify hole size and placement.
  • Durability and finish: High-temperature firing (like 1380°C) improves glaze durability. Choose finishes that resist fading and moisture exposure.
  • Drain and faucet options: Faucets and drains are typically not included. Plan for compatible fixtures and any extra installation hardware.

Frequently Asked Questions

  1. Are vessel sinks harder to install than undermount sinks? Vessel sinks can require different mounting hardware and plumbing paths, especially for countertop installations. Plan for a sturdy vanity and compatible faucet setup.
  2. What is the best material for a vanity countertop with a vessel sink? Sintered stone and ceramic countertops are durable and resist moisture, making them suitable for vessel sinks in bathrooms with heavy use.
  3. How do I choose between a floating or freestanding vanity? Floating designs maximize floor space and simplify cleaning, while freestanding vanities offer floor-based stability and more storage options.
  4. Do all vessel sinks require a pre-drilled faucet hole? Not always. Some models have a single central drain hole and require wall-mounted or deck-mounted faucets if no top deck holes exist.
  5. Can a small vanity accommodate a vessel sink? Yes, especially compact round or rectangular vessels paired with a suitable vanity. Ensure the drain and faucet clearance align with the sink.
  6. Is professional installation recommended for these vanities? For floating or wall-mounted vanities, professional installation is often advisable to ensure proper support and plumbing alignment.
